Concise Biography

BROWNLEY, Julia, a Representative from California; born in Aiken, Aiken County, S.C., August 28, 1952; graduated from Fairfax Hall, Waynesboro, Va., 1970; B.A., Mount Vernon College (now the George Washington University), Washington, D.C., 1975; M.B.A., American University, Washington, D.C., 1979; marketing executive; member of the Santa Monica-Malibu school district board, 1994-2006; member of the California state assembly, 2006-2012; elected as a Democrat to the One Hundred Thirteenth and to the six succeeding Congresses (January 3, 2013-present).
